The Grinnell (IA) Herald; Dec. 26, 1919

CHARLIE RAINSBURG DIES.

Messages were received in Brooklyn on last Thursday announcing the death of Mr. C.T. Rainsburg, a former resident and merchant of Brooklyn.

Mr. Rainsburg was born in Brooklyn on May 13, 1869, and died in Kansas City, Mo., on Dec. 10, 1919. He was educated in the Brooklyn schools, graduating therefrom in 1887. Immediately after his graduation from school he purchased an interest in a drug store in Brooklyn and was thereafter continuously engaged in the drug and jewelry business in Brooklyn for more than twenty-three years. He removed with his family to Kansas City in 1910.

On July 23, 1891, Mr. Rainsburg was married to Miss Eva Dorrance, daughter of O.F. Dorrance. To this union one son, Ross, was born. Both the widow and son survive.

About eight years ago Mr. Rainsburg was stricken with apoplexy and since that time had been unable to give any attention to business. Other attacks followed at infrequent intervals, the last one coming about four days prior to his death.

Mr. Rainsburg was very prominent in the business and social life of Brooklyn during his residence here, and all of his acquaintances were his friends. He was kind-hearted, generous and possessed of a most happy and cheerful disposition. He was a member of the local Knights of Pythias and I.O.O.F. lodges.--Brooklyn Chronicle
